It’s not rocket science is an idiom that means the task or subject under discussion is not difficult, that a task should be easy to perform or a subject should be easy to understand. The job of a rocket scientist requires proficiency with physics, chemistry, aerodynamics, propulsion, communications and mathematics. What are some skills, both technical and nontechnical, that rocket scientists need? For instance, an aerospace engineer who specializes in chemistry and propulsion dynamics may work on a spacecraft’s fuel issues. A rocket scientist, or aerospace engineer, may specialize in one or more fields of study, and this will determine what kind of job he or she looks for.
